Ethyl-(S)-(-)-lactate, EMPLURA®
Supplier: Merck
Ethyl lactate is a safer and more sustainable alternative to ethyl acetate and acetone. It is an ester of natural L-lactic acid, which is produced by fermentation of sugar.

Glycerine 98.0-101.0% (by alkalimetry) ACS, Reag. Ph. Eur.
Supplier: Merck
Bio-Based Glycerol
Our bio-based glycerol is produced from rapeseed, a renewable raw material, and a by-product of biodiesel production. It offers numerous advantages compared to petroleum-derived glycerol.
